What is the Policy on “Can you use a calculator on the CCENT exam”?
The question of whether you can use a calculator on the CCENT exam has a straightforward but nuanced answer. Firstly, the CCENT (Cisco Certified Entry Networking Technician) certification was officially retired by Cisco on February 24, 2020. It was replaced by the consolidated CCNA certification. However, the policy regarding calculators has remained consistent. For both the old CCENT and the new CCNA, the rule is firm: you cannot bring your own personal calculator into the testing center. This policy is in place to maintain a secure and standardized testing environment.
While personal devices are banned, test-takers are not left completely without resources. Pearson VUE, the company that administers Cisco exams, provides a basic on-screen digital calculator built into the exam software. This ensures that all candidates have access to the same tool for any necessary calculations. The common misconception is that no calculators are available at all, but the key distinction is between personal and provided tools. Therefore, the core of the issue about whether you can use a calculator on the CCENT exam (and now the CCNA) is about *which* calculator is permitted.

Practical Examples (Real-World Use Cases)
Let’s look at two examples where knowing the calculator policy is vital.
Example 1: Subnetting a /24 Network
An administrator is given the 192.168.10.0/24 network and needs to create 4 equal-sized subnets. Since you must perform this on the exam, you’d use the provided whiteboard. You need 2 bits for 4 subnets (2^2 = 4). This changes the CIDR to /26. A /26 mask is 255.255.255.192. The “block size” is 256 – 192 = 64. Your subnets are 192.168.10.0, 192.168.10.64, 192.168.10.128, and 192.168.10.192. This shows that while the on-screen calculator helps with simple math, the core logic relies on your knowledge, not a complex calculator.
Example 2: Determining a Wildcard Mask
You need to create an ACL that matches the subnet 172.16.32.0 with a mask of 255.255.240.0. The question of can you use a calculator on the CCENT exam is less important here than knowing the method. To find the wildcard mask, you subtract the subnet mask from 255.255.255.255.
255.255.255.255 – 255.255.240.0 = 0.0.15.255.
This is a simple subtraction you can do on the whiteboard. The on-screen calculator is available if needed, but practicing this calculation manually is faster and more reliable during the exam.

Key Factors That Affect Exam Success
Passing the CCNA involves more than just calculation skills. Here are six factors that are critical for success:
- Time Management: The exam is timed (120 minutes). You must be able to answer questions quickly, especially subnetting problems. Don’t get stuck on one question.
- Mastering Subnetting: This is the most calculation-heavy part of the exam. You must be able to do it quickly and accurately by hand. Practice is the only way. A great resource is CCENT subnetting practice.
- Understanding the Exam Interface: Familiarize yourself with the Pearson VUE exam format, including how to access the on-screen calculator and digital whiteboard. Not knowing this can cost you valuable time.
- Using the Erasable Board Effectively: As soon as the exam starts, write down your subnetting charts, powers of 2, and any other data you’ve memorized. This “brain dump” is allowed and essential.
- Strong Theoretical Knowledge: Many questions are scenario-based or theoretical. Rote memorization is not enough; you must understand the concepts behind the technology.
- Adherence to Cisco exam policies: Knowing the rules, such as the policy on calculators, prevents stress and potential disqualification on exam day.
